SubjectRe: Device-mapper submission for 2.4
On Tue, 9 Dec 2003, William Lee Irwin III wrote:

> Just apply the patch if you're for some reason terrified of 2.6.

Or get RedHat or Fedora to apply the patch.

Its a slightly safer bet though to have it in stock 2.4, guarantees
it will be there if one needs it 2 years down the road when upgrading
some box. (and non-LVM users wont be compiling it in).

So personally I'd rather Marcelo included it, being paranoid about
having support for access to data.
